Output 8d63eeaa24397b2bc045686c7bea86632c10a3a63d05513d32331af1d355a30a:7

value
134415187
script pubkey
OP_0 OP_PUSHBYTES_32 4492feffcd8c2e06d7a98e64d66dfdb0fed037a12f82a8cdd529cc74fff039f2
address
bc1qgjf0al7d3shqd4af3ejdvm0akrldqdap97p23nw498x8flls88eqz4sd5e
transaction
8d63eeaa24397b2bc045686c7bea86632c10a3a63d05513d32331af1d355a30a
spent
true